Grantsville awards Phase 1 park construction contract to Strong Excavation
Summary
The council approved Resolution 2025-71 awarding the City Slopes/Sandy Smith Park Phase 1 contract to Strong Excavation; staff said phase funding will come from a $5 million bond, park impact fees and grants, with alternates (restrooms, fencing) to be added later if funding allows.

The Grantsville City Council voted Sept. 17 to award the Phase 1 contract for City Slopes (Sandy Smith) Park to Strong Excavation under Resolution 2025-71.
Staff presented the project scope and bid information, saying seven companies bid and Strong Excavation offered the lowest responsible bid. Phase 1 scope listed by staff includes demolition, grading, electrical stubs for future lighting, base paving and irrigation, artificial turf areas around the bike pump track, landscaping and other site work. Staff identified several bid alternates — a restroom, backstop and fencing, dugouts and retaining walls — that the council may add later depending on funding.
Council members pressed staff on schedule, phasing and oversight. Staff said the project would be paid largely from a $5 million bond combined with park impact fees and grants (including state-level funding sources); staff also said grant timelines (some grants not yet open) and potential environmental or permitting constraints could affect schedules. Council asked for a timetable to ensure coordination with other projects (notably a separate American Ramp Company contract) and emphasized the need for a project manager and inspection regime; staff said a bond and project oversight procedures will help ensure quality.
Committee member (speaker 4) moved to adopt Resolution 2025-71 to award the contract; Chair seconded and the motion passed with unanimous 'Aye' votes.
Staff said they would return with final contract documents and timelines and will track change orders and alternates against available funding.
